The holy Prophet cursed these who would disobey the army of Usamah.1 On the day of 26th Safar, 11 years after Hijrat, the holy Prophet ordered the people to get ready for the expedition to Rome. On the next day he called Usamah bin Zaid and said: "Go towards the place where your father was killed. Raise an army for them as I have made you the commander of this army." On the next day, which was Wednesday, the Prophet became ill. He had fever and headache.
On Thursday the Prophet gave the flag to Usamah and told him: "By the name of Allah and in the way of Allah, fight with those who disbelieve in God." Usamah came out with the flag, and gave it to Burida Ibn Hasib Aslami, and arranged the army in groups, so that no earlier muslim (Mohajirs and Ansars) were left but were recalled to the war. They included Abu Bakr, Umar Ibn Khattab, Abu Ubaidah Jarrah, Sa'ad Ibn Abi Waqqas, Sa'eid Ibn Zaid, Qutada Ibn Noman, and Salma Ibn Aslam.
Some persons remarked about the Usamah and said: "This young has been made the Commander over the elders! So the holy Prophet became very angry. He came out while he had wrapped a cloth on himself. Then he went on the pulpit and said: "The talk of some people about the selection of Usamah as a commander has reached me.
